#main-content{background-color:#fbf8f2}.post{margin:0 auto;max-width:1362px;padding:60px 40px}.post h1,.post h2,.post h3,.post h4,.post h5,.post h6,.post p{margin:0;padding:0}.post .post__title h1{color:#031e2f;font-family:Thesaurus Std;font-size:72px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:60px;text-align:center}.post .post__featured--img{height:654px;margin-bottom:120px}.post .post__featured--img img{height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;width:100%}.post .post__body{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ap;-ms-flex-line-pack:start;align-content:flex-start}.post .post__body .post__content{-webkit-box-flex:0;-ms-flex:0 0 50%;flex:0 0 50%}.post .post__body .post__content .post__main{color:#031e2f;font-family:Thesaurus Std;font-size:40px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:40px;margin-top:-6px;max-width:500px}.post .post__body .post__content .post__courtesy{color:#031e2f;font-family:Thesaurus Std;font-size:16px;font-style:normal;font-weight:400;line-height:140%}.post .post__body .post__recipes{-webkit-box-flex:0;border-left:1px solid rgba(3,30,47,.1);-ms-flex:0 0 50%;flex:0 0 50%;padding-left:82px}.post .post__body .post__recipes h4{color:#031e2f;font-family:Thesaurus Std;font-size:20px;font-style:normal;font-weight:700;line-height:334%;margin-bottom:2px}.post .post__body .post__recipes ol,.post .post__body .post__recipes ul{margin:0;padding:0 0 0 15px}.post .post__body .post__recipes ol li,.post .post__body .post__recipes ul li{color:#031e2f;font-family:Thesaurus Std;font-size:18px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:30px}.post .post__body .post__recipes ol li:last-child,.post .post__body .post__recipes ul li:last-child{margin-bottom:0}.post .post__body .post__recipes h6{color:#031e2f;font-family:Thesaurus Std;font-size:18px;line-height:130%;margin-bottom:30px}.post .post__body .post__recipes h6:last-child{margin-bottom:0}.post .post__body .post__recipes p{color:#031e2f;font-family:Thesaurus Std;font-size:18px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:30px;margin-top:30px}.post .post__body .post__recipes p:first-child{margin-top:0}.post .post__body .post__recipes p:last-child{margin-bottom:0}.post .post__body .post__ingredients h4{color:#031e2f;font-family:Thesaurus Std;font-size:20px;font-style:normal;font-weight:700;line-height:334%;margin-bottom:2px}.post .post__body .post__ingredients ol,.post .post__body .post__ingredients ul{margin:0;padding:0 0 0 15px}.post .post__body .post__ingredients ol li,.post .post__body .post__ingredients ul li{color:#031e2f;font-family:Thesaurus Std;font-size:18px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:30px}.post .post__body .post__ingredients ol li:last-child,.post .post__body .post__ingredients ul li:last-child{margin-bottom:0}.post .post__body .post__ingredients h6{color:#031e2f;font-family:Thesaurus Std;font-size:18px;line-height:130%;margin-bottom:30px}.post .post__body .post__ingredients h6:last-child{margin-bottom:0}.post .post__body .post__ingredients p{color:#031e2f;font-family:Thesaurus Std;font-size:18px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:30px;margin-top:30px}.post .post__body .post__ingredients p:first-child{margin-top:0}.post .post__body .post__ingredients p:last-child{margin-bottom:0}.post .post__body .post__content .post__ingredients{margin-top:20px}.post .post__body .post__recipes .post__directions{margin-top:-22px}@media only screen and (max-width:1051px){.post{margin:0 auto;max-width:1362px;padding:60px 40px 40px}.post h1,.post h2,.post h3,.post h4,.post h5,.post h6,.post p{margin:0;padding:0}.post .post__title h1{color:#031e2f;font-family:Thesaurus Std;font-size:64px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:40px;text-align:center}.post .post__featured--img{height:384px;margin-bottom:56px}.post .post__featured--img img{height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;width:100%}.post .post__body{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ap;-ms-flex-line-pack:start;align-content:flex-start}.post .post__body .post__content{-webkit-box-flex:0;-ms-flex:0 0 50%;flex:0 0 50%}.post .post__body .post__content .post__main{color:#031e2f;font-family:Thesaurus Std;font-size:24px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:32px;margin-top:0;max-width:317px}.post .post__body .post__content .post__courtesy{color:#031e2f;font-family:Thesaurus Std;font-size:16px;font-style:normal;font-weight:400;line-height:140%}.post .post__body .post__recipes{-webkit-box-flex:0;border-left:1px solid rgba(3,30,47,.1);-ms-flex:0 0 50%;flex:0 0 50%;padding-left:0}.post .post__body .post__recipes h4{color:#031e2f;font-family:Thesaurus Std;font-size:20px;font-style:normal;font-weight:700;line-height:334%;margin-bottom:2px}.post .post__body .post__recipes ol,.post .post__body .post__recipes ul{margin:0;padding:0 0 0 15px}.post .post__body .post__recipes ol li,.post .post__body .post__recipes ul li{color:#031e2f;font-family:Thesaurus Std;font-size:18px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:30px}.post .post__body .post__recipes ol li:last-child,.post .post__body .post__recipes ul li:last-child{margin-bottom:0}.post .post__body .post__recipes h6{color:#031e2f;font-family:Thesaurus Std;font-size:18px;line-height:130%;margin-bottom:30px}.post .post__body .post__recipes h6:last-child{margin-bottom:0}.post .post__body .post__recipes p{color:#031e2f;font-family:Thesaurus Std;font-size:18px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:30px}.post .post__body .post__recipes p:last-child{margin-bottom:0}.post .post__body .post__content .post__ingredients{margin-top:20px;padding-right:32px}.post .post__body .post__recipes .post__directions{padding-left:32px}}@media only screen and (max-width:767px){.post{margin:0 auto;max-width:100%;padding:64px 24px 40px}.post h1,.post h2,.post h3,.post h4,.post h5,.post h6,.post p{margin:0;padding:0}.post .post__title{margin:0 -11px}.post .post__title h1{color:#031e2f;font-family:Thesaurus Std;font-size:56px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:24px;text-align:center}.post .post__featured--img{height:366px;margin-bottom:24px}.post .post__featured--img img{height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;width:100%}.post .post__body{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-flow:row wrap;flex-flow:row wrap;-ms-flex-line-pack:start;align-content:flex-start}.post .post__body .post__content{-webkit-box-flex:0;-ms-flex:0 0 100%;flex:0 0 100%}.post .post__body .post__content .post__main{color:#031e2f;font-family:Thesaurus Std;font-size:28px;font-style:normal;font-weight:400;line-height:140%;margin-bottom:32px;margin-top:0;max-width:100%}.post .post__body .post__content .post__courtesy{color:#031e2f;font-family:Thesaurus Std;font-size:16px;font-style:normal;font-weight:400;line-height:140%;margin-bottom:48px}.post .post__body .post__recipes{-webkit-box-flex:0;border-left:0;border-top:1px solid rgba(3,30,47,.1);-ms-flex:0 0 100%;flex:0 0 100%;padding-left:0}.post .post__body .post__recipes h4{color:#031e2f;font-family:Thesaurus Std;font-size:20px;font-style:normal;font-weight:700;line-height:334%;margin-bottom:2px}.post .post__body .post__recipes ol,.post .post__body .post__recipes ul{margin:0;padding:0 0 0 15px}.post .post__body .post__recipes ol li,.post .post__body .post__recipes ul li{color:#031e2f;font-family:Thesaurus Std;font-size:18px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:30px}.post .post__body .post__recipes ol li:last-child,.post .post__body .post__recipes ul li:last-child{margin-bottom:0}.post .post__body .post__recipes h6{color:#031e2f;font-family:Thesaurus Std;font-size:18px;line-height:130%;margin-bottom:30px}.post .post__body .post__recipes h6:last-child{margin-bottom:0}.post .post__body .post__recipes p{color:#031e2f;font-family:Thesaurus Std;font-size:18px;font-style:normal;font-weight:400;line-height:130%;margin-bottom:30px}.post .post__body .post__recipes p:last-child{margin-bottom:0}.post .post__body .post__content .post__ingredients{border-top:1px solid rgba(3,30,47,.1);margin-bottom:40px;padding-left:0;padding-top:24px}.post .post__body .post__recipes .post__directions{margin-top:0;padding-left:0;padding-top:24px}}